Notes from the Driftmail plugin sync, Tuesday session. Digest batching will move to a fixed four-hour window; plugin authors must declare scheduling hints in the manifest by the next minor release. Late-registered hooks will be queued to the following window, not dropped. Questions about migration timing should go to the scheduling lead listed below.

named custodian: Fraion Holael

- [ ] Image cache leak in Pixelbarn's thumbnail service: heap keeps growing because evicted entries still hold decoded bitmaps via a listener that never unregisters. Not a classic vuln, but it's a solid DoS vector if someone spams large uploads. Verify the fix caps cache size by bytes, not count, and that eviction actually frees native memory. Flag anything sketchy to the engineer who owns this component.

signatory, fafog-bagef: Jorwyn Juleth Pelius

Finance Review Summary — Customer Concentration, Verelux Group

Revenue concentration remains elevated: the Dunmoor account represents 31% of recurring income, up from 26% last year. Two further accounts together add 18%. Contract renewal timing clusters in the second quarter, compounding exposure. Heads of department should factor this into hiring and inventory commitments. Mitigation options are under review, and the confidential note below sets out the plan.

internal memo for faweg-hahip: Silokix Works plans to lower the Tamvan list price by 8 percent in June.